When It’s Time to Get Your A/c Repaired
Is the level of comfort in your house falling short of what you would like it to be? There are other, more subtle issues that, if overlooked, could result in more severe repairs or the need for an early replacement of your a/c. While a system that will not turn on is a clear sign that you require repair work, there are other, less apparent problems. If you recognize with the more subtle signs of a problem with your a/c, you will be able to get in touch with a expert service professional quicker instead of later on.
If any of the following apply, one of our Missouri AC repair professionals advises that you give us a call:
- You are sustaining an boost in the quantity of cash required to spend for your month-to-month utility expenses: Inefficient operation of your air conditioner can be brought on by a number of various concerns, including dripping ductwork, an internal breakdown, or a faulty thermostat. This means that it needs to work harder to keep your property cool, which will result in a substantial increase in the quantity that you pay in utility bills.
- You only notice hot air coming out of your vents: First things initially, ensure you have not accidentally set the thermostat to the incorrect temperature level by examining it. If that is not the case, then you probably have a issue on the inside of your a/c unit, and you ought to get it inspected by a professional.
- You are seeing a higher humidity level at your residential or commercial property: Even though this is not the primary function of your air conditioning unit, it is accountable for managing the humidity level inside of your home or industrial structure. Higher humidity suggests that there is an excess of moisture in the air, which can lead to the growth of mold and mildew in addition to making the air feel warm and sticky. It is important that you get this matter resolved as rapidly as humanly possible, especially for the sake of your safety.
- The air flow in your unit is inadequate: Regrettably, there are a wide range of elements that can result in insufficient airflow. We will need to carry out a extensive evaluation in order to find out whether the issue is the outcome of a clogged up air filter, an concern with the blower, frozen evaporator coils, dripping ductwork, or obstructed air ducts.
- You observe that there is a substantial quantity of wetness in the location around your unit: Condensation is a natural event, nevertheless it should not exist in extreme quantities. It is possible that you have a dripping refrigerant or a stopped up drain tube if you notice any excess moisture or pooling water in the location.
- Strange Noises from Your Unit: It is to be expected for an air conditioning system to create some background sound while it is running. On the other hand, if it starts making audible screeching, squealing, grinding, groaning, or scraping noises, this is an obvious indication that something requires to be fixed.
- It appears that there is a problem with your thermostat: It’s possible that the thermostat is the source of the issues you’re having with your ac system. If you have hot and cold locations around your home, your system won’t shut off, or it won’t begin, it could be because of a problem with the thermostat. The HVAC System Is Making Weird Noises
There are a couple of sounds that ought to not be heard coming from a/c even though they do not operate completely silence. These sounds might be anything from a banging to a screeching to a grinding to a clicking sound. These particular sounds often show that there is a problem within the air conditioning unit that has to be repaired by a expert of in St. Charles County.
Sounds that are Weird and Different Coming From Your AC The following ought to be included:
- Banging: The issue is generally the compressor in an air conditioner that is making a banging noise. This element of the air conditioner is responsible for delivering refrigerant to the various other parts of the unit in order to remove excess heat from your home. Compressor parts might relax as the a/c system ages. This noise is triggered by the parts moving and rattling and crashing one another.
- Screeching: A damaged blower fan motor within the air conditioning system might produce a sound comparable to screeching or squealing if the motor is working improperly. Generally, a defective fan belt or broken bearings in the motor are to blame for this noise. Switch off the air conditioner immediately and connect with a professional for repairs whenever you hear a screeching sound.
- Grinding: The noise of something grinding is never ever a great indication to hear coming from any type of mechanical object. Pistons inside the compressor may have broken, which might result in this grinding noise originating from the air conditioning. When a compressor’s pistons become worn, it usually shows that the compressor itself needs to be changed. The complete a/c system might need to be replaced depending upon the model of air conditioning and how old it is.
- Clicking: It is very normal for an a/c unit to make a clicking noise when it at first switches on. If you hear clicking throughout the whole period of the cooling cycle, then there is a issue with the clicking. These clicks are the result of a thermostat that is not working appropriately.
